Subject outline

In this subjects you will be introduced to early childhood curriculum design, implementation and evaluation. In professional experience settings, you will create learning experiences in consultation with children, families and educators. You will be introduced to intentional and spontaneous teaching strategies, and assessment and evaluation approaches. You will undertake 14 days of Professional Experience within the three to five age group.
